恢复MySQL数据库的单个表可以通过以下步骤实现:
- 确定备份策略:在恢复数据库之前,必须确保已经有可用的备份文件,以便恢复单个表。可以通过定期备份整个数据库或仅备份特定表的方式进行备份。腾讯云提供了数据库备份和恢复服务,可以通过云数据库MySQL控制台设置自动备份。
- 创建临时数据库:为了恢复单个表,可以创建一个临时数据库,将备份文件恢复到该临时数据库中。
- 导入备份文件:使用MySQL的命令行工具或图形界面工具,将备份文件导入到临时数据库中。例如,可以使用以下命令导入备份文件:
- 导入备份文件:使用MySQL的命令行工具或图形界面工具,将备份文件导入到临时数据库中。例如,可以使用以下命令导入备份文件:
- 恢复目标表:一旦备份文件被成功导入到临时数据库中,可以使用以下命令将目标表从临时数据库恢复到原始数据库:
- 恢复目标表:一旦备份文件被成功导入到临时数据库中,可以使用以下命令将目标表从临时数据库恢复到原始数据库:
- 这将从临时数据库中选取目标表的所有数据,并插入到原始数据库的目标表中。
- 删除临时数据库:在完成单个表的恢复后,可以删除临时数据库以释放资源。
请注意,这只是一种常见的方法来恢复MySQL数据库的单个表,具体步骤可能因环境和需求而有所不同。
腾讯云提供的相关产品和服务:
- 云数据库MySQL:腾讯云提供的稳定可靠的MySQL数据库服务,支持自动备份和恢复,具有高可用性和可扩展性。产品介绍链接:https://cloud.tencent.com/product/cdb_mysql
- 云数据库备份与回档:腾讯云提供的数据库备份和回档服务,可以自动定期备份数据库,并支持按需恢复整个数据库或单个表。产品介绍链接:https://cloud.tencent.com/product/cbs
请注意,以上仅为示例,如果您有其他需求或使用其他云服务提供商的产品,可以根据实际情况进行调整。